Background
Skittles and his family were rescued by a kind lady who discovered a stray mama had given birth to kittens outside a local business. Concerned for their safety, she took them home and contacted Regina Cat Rescue for help. The little family has done well and are ready to find forever homes.
Skittles is a fun, playful little guy that loves other cats and is always on the go. He doesn't like to be held but he loves to have his belly rubbed and enjoys attention from his foster dad. He likes to sleep with his foster dad, and makes sure his little paw is always touching his foster dad's hand.
